The Shoes

PHOTO PROMPT © Roger Bultot 

It started as a joke, but then became suddenly serious. I never found what prompted Pete to take the joke as far as he did, but here we are. I was originally told the shoes belonged to his brother, and every time Jace made him mad, Pete would throw his favorite shoes around the pole so they would quickly become ruined.  

Now having been to Pete’s house, I know he doesn’t have a brother. And that the shoes he keeps destroying are his own and represent one of his major sins. A sin that coincided with a murder in town.
